Adrienne A.

Service and presentation are top notch at this little spot. On this visit, we tried the beef bulgogi, the chicken teriyaki, the dumplings, and bone-in wings with the soy garlic sauce. Everything was expertly prepared. The wings were humongous - perhaps the biggest wings I've had in my life. The soy garlic sauce was good but I might try another sauce on a future visit. The dumplings were perfectly fried and ample - 6 dumplings for $6. One member of my party was particularly impressed with the dumplings. Of the two entrees, we all preferred the beef bulgogi. The teriyaki chicken needed either more sauce or a more robust sauce. We also tried the spicy version of the teriyaki sauce and this was an improvement. We were given complimentary bowls of miso soup and I thought the soup was very good. Service was kind and attentive and overall it was a great experience.

Emmett T.

I have seen numerous eateries over the years trying to do business at this standalone building in front of a large car wash. The current iteration is a Korean restaurant serving a limited menu of standard items like bulgogi, bibimbap, cupbap, ramen, and fried chicken wings. Orders were strictly take-out as they were not permitting on-site dining in their small eating area. I picked a six-piece of Korean wings with a half and half flavor combination of Soy Garlic and Korean Zing. The wings were separated in a container by tin foil with the three non-spicy pieces on top and the three spicy ones on the bottom. They were not large, and the crust was not very crispy. The soy garlic flavor was decent while the Korean zing was mildly spicy. The other part of my order was a bibimbap with beef. White rice was provided in a separate container while the marinated beef, assorted vegetables, and cup of gochujang sauce were placed together in a circular aluminum pan. The amount of rice to the protein and veggies was good, however it was the sauce that tied the dish together with a spicy flavor. The food was prepared in about ten minutes and brought out to my car where I was waiting. For the quality and price, K-BBQ was an average three star dining experience.
